I didn't really do any break in for mine. I had to go out of town for 160 miles in order to find one and the easiest way to get it home was to ride it home on the divided highway. I tried to do some wind up, wind down of the rpms while riding so it didn't just drone along at 7000 rpm for three hours and made two stops to let the engine cool and heat up again. My bike runs great now. No ticking noises and is great on gas at 84 mpg US.
